Comprehending Bespoke Secondary Glazing
Secondary glazing involves the installation of a fully independent internal window frame on the space side of the existing primary window. Unlike "off-the-shelf" kits, bespoke solutions are custom-manufactured to the millimetre. This accuracy is crucial due to the fact that older buildings seldom include completely square window openings. Bespoke frames are engineered to follow the subtle contours of the initial architecture, guaranteeing a seamless fit that takes full advantage of performance.
The Mechanics of Performance
The effectiveness of Secondary Glazing Bespoke Solutions glazing counts on the development of a caught cushion of air between the 2 panes. When bespoke systems are set up, this air space acts as a powerful insulator. For thermal performance, a smaller sized space is typically enough; nevertheless, for optimum soundproofing, a larger gap (normally in between 100mm and 200mm) is made use of to decouple the two panes of glass, avoiding sound vibrations from going through easily.

1. Superior Thermal Insulation
Requirement single glazing is a significant source of heat loss. Bespoke Secondary Glazing Security units can decrease heat loss through windows by approximately 60%. By using Low-E (low-emissivity) glass, the system reflects heat back into the space, minimizing energy consumption and lowering utility costs.
2. Extraordinary Acoustic Reduction
For properties located near hectic roadways, railway lines, or flight paths, sound pollution can substantially impact quality of life. Bespoke Secondary Glazing Styles glazing is extensively concerned as the most effective solution for sound reduction, efficient in lowering external sound levels by as much as 80% (approximately 50 decibels).
3. Preservation of Heritage
Due to the fact that the system is set up internally, it does not require planning authorization in the huge majority of cases-- even for Grade I and Grade II listed buildings. It enables the initial lumber or metal frames to stay untouched and noticeable from the outside.
4. Enhanced Security
A bespoke secondary unit includes an additional physical barrier versus intruders. When fitted with toughened or laminated glass and high-quality locking systems, it becomes considerably more tough to breach than a single-pane window alone.

Often Asked Questions (FAQ)Does secondary glazing cause condensation?
Among the primary causes of condensation is poor ventilation and the temperature level difference between the glass and the space. Bespoke secondary glazing, when fitted with an airtight seal, prevents warm, damp room air from reaching the cold main pane. Professional installers often consist of small vents or desiccants if a property is particularly susceptible to moisture.
Can secondary glazing be eliminated if needed?
Yes. A lot of custom systems are developed to be "reversible." This is a key reason why conservation officers authorize of them; it allows the building to be returned to its initial state without long-term damage to the historical fabric.
How much does bespoke secondary glazing expense?
The cost varies depending upon the glass type, frame surface, and complexity of the installation. While it is more costly than DIY plastic packages, it is considerably more cost effective than changing whole window systems with double glazing-- particularly when scaffolding and structural licenses are factored in.
Is it possible to match the colour of my existing windows?
Definitely. Bespoke aluminium frames are typically powder-coated and can be finished in over 200 RAL colours, in addition to wood-grain surfaces, to ensure they blend completely with the existing interior design.
How do I clean up the windows after setup?
The systems are developed with maintenance in mind. Sliders can be moved to access the rear, hinged units swing open, and lift-out systems can be completely gotten rid of to permit occasional cleansing of the "inner" faces of the glass.
